How to Read a Bird Band— A Handy Guide

WebTo start, he gives each bird a USGS metal band on the lower left leg containing nine numbers: a four-digit prefix and a five-digit suffix. This federal band acts as the bird’s unique social security number. Black Skimmer banded in 2024. Photo: Jean Hall. WebBeware of banding nestlings at too advanced an age (they may ‘explode’ from the nest). Use the correct band size and banding pliers for each bird. Keep careful and accurate records of all birds banded and submit schedules to the Department of Conservation Banding Office. Treat all bird injuries in the most humane way.
